Remove padding from columns in Bootstrap 3

Problem:

Remove padding/margin to the right and left of col-md-* in Bootstrap 3.

Bootstrap 5 has added vertical and horizontal gutter classses

Bootstrap 4 has added .no-gutters class.

Bootstrap 3.4 has added .row-no-gutters class

Bootstrap 3: I always add this style to my Bootstrap LESS / SASS:

.row-no-padding {
  [class*="col-"] {
    padding-left: 0 !important;
    padding-right: 0 !important;
  }
}

Then in the HTML you can write:

<div class="row row-no-padding">

If you want to only target the child columns you can use the child selector (Thanks John Wu).

.row-no-padding > [class*="col-"] {
    padding-left: 0 !important;
    padding-right: 0 !important;
}

You may also want to remove padding only for certain device sizes (SASS example):

/* Small devices (tablets, 768px and up) */
@media (min-width: $screen-sm-min) and (max-width: $screen-sm-max) {
  .row-sm-no-padding {
    [class*="col-"] {
      padding-left: 0 !important;
      padding-right: 0 !important;
    }
  }
}

You can remove the max-width part of the media query if you want it to support small devices upwards.

Bootstrap 3, since version 3.4.0, has an official way of removing the padding: the class row-no-gutters.

Example from the documentation:

<div class="row row-no-gutters">
  <div class="col-xs-12 col-md-8">.col-xs-12 .col-md-8</div>
  <div class="col-xs-6 col-md-4">.col-xs-6 .col-md-4</div>
</div>
<div class="row row-no-gutters">
  <div class="col-xs-6 col-md-4">.col-xs-6 .col-md-4</div>
  <div class="col-xs-6 col-md-4">.col-xs-6 .col-md-4</div>
  <div class="col-xs-6 col-md-4">.col-xs-6 .col-md-4</div>
</div>
<div class="row row-no-gutters">
  <div class="col-xs-6">.col-xs-6</div>
  <div class="col-xs-6">.col-xs-6</div>
</div>

You'd normally use .row to wrap two columns, not .col-md-12 - that's a column encasing another column. Afterall, .row doesn't have the extra margins and padding that a col-md-12 would bring and also discounts the space that a column would introduce with negative left & right margins.

<div class="container">
    <div class="row">
        <h2>OntoExplorer<span style="color:#b92429">.</span></h2>

        <div class="col-md-4 nopadding">
            <div class="widget">
                <div class="widget-header">
                    <h3>Dimensions</h3>
                </div>
                <div class="widget-content">
                </div>
            </div>
        </div>

        <div class="col-md-8 nopadding">
            <div class="widget">
                <div class="widget-header">
                    <h3>Results</h3>
                </div>
                <div class="widget-content">
                </div>
            </div>
        </div>
    </div>
</div>

if you really wanted to remove the padding/margins, add a class to filter out the margins/paddings for each child column.

.nopadding {
   padding: 0 !important;
   margin: 0 !important;
}

Reducing just the padding on the columns won't make the trick, as you will extend the width of the page, making it uneven with the rest of your page, say navbar. You need to equally reduce the negative margin on the row. Taking @martinedwards' LESS example:

.row-no-padding {
  margin-left: 0;
  margin-right: 0;
  [class*="col-"] {
    padding-left: 0 !important;
    padding-right: 0 !important;
  }
}

Another solution, feasible only if you compile bootstrap from its LESS sources, is to redefine the variable which sets the padding for the columns.

You will find the variable in the variables.less file: it's called @grid-gutter-width.

It's described like this in the sources:

//** Padding between columns. Gets divided in half for the left and right.
@grid-gutter-width:         30px;

Set this to 0, compile bootstrap.less, and include the resulting bootstrap.css. You are done. It can be an alternative to defining an additional rule, if you are already using bootstrap sources like I am.
